Discrete-Time Semi-Markov Random Evolutions – Average and Diffusion Approximation of Difference Equations and Additive Functionals

Communications in Statistics - Theory and Methods, 2011
This article introduces discrete-time semi-Markov random evolution and studies asymptotic properties, namely, averaging and diffusion approximation by weak convergence methods. The cases considered here concern difference equations and additive functionals with application in estimation of stationary probability of semi-Markov chains.

ON NEW ADDITIVE DIFFERENCE METHOD FOR PARABOLIC EQUATIONS

Mathematical Models and Methods in Applied Sciences, 1996
A new approach is suggested to the construction of conservative difference schemes for multidimensional second-order parabolic equations containing divergent first-order differential forms. These schemes hold the property of having fixed sign for non-negative solutions. The convergence of schemes is proved in the grid norm L2 at the rate O(τ + h2).
